ROIJLOC_TREE SAP (Tree structure for (planning) locations) Structure details
Description: Tree structure for (planning) locations
Structure field list including key, data, relationships and ABAP select examples
ROIJLOC_TREE is a standard SAP Structure so does not store data like a database table does. It can be used to define the fields of other actual tables or to process "Tree structure for (planning) locations" Information within sap ABAP programs.
This is done by declaring abap internal tables, work areas or database tables based on this Structure. These can then be used to store and process the required data appropriately.
i.e. DATA: wa_ROIJLOC_TREE TYPE ROIJLOC_TREE.
The ROIJLOC_TREE table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about Tree structure for (planning) locations data available in SAP. These include LOCID (Location ID), LOCTYP (OIL-TSW: Location type), LOCNAM (Location name (used by system owner)), KNOTE (OIL-TSW: Transport connection point (node reference)).. SAP ROIJLOC_TREE structure fields - Full list of fields found in SAP data dictionary
Field | Description | Data Element | Data Type | length (Dec) | Check table | Conversion Routine | Domain Name | MemoryID | SHLP |
MANDT | Client | MANDT | CLNT | 3 | Assigned to domain | MANDT | |||
LOCID | Location ID | OIJ_LOCID | CHAR | 10 | Assigned to domain | OIJ_LOCID | OIX | ||
LOCTYP | OIL-TSW: Location type | OIJ_LOCTYP | CHAR | 4 | Assigned to domain | OIJ_LOCTYP | |||
LOCNAM | Location name (used by system owner) | OIJ_LOCNAM | CHAR | 60 | OIJ_LOCNAM | ||||
KNOTE | OIL-TSW: Transport connection point (node reference) | OIJ_KNOTE | CHAR | 10 | Assigned to domain | KNOTN | |||
PLANLOC | OIL-TSW: Planning location | OIJ_PLANLO | CHAR | 10 | Assigned to domain | OIJ_LOCID | |||
ERDAT | Date on Which Record Was Created | ERDAT | DATS | 8 | DATUM | ||||
ERZEIT | Time of creation | OI0_ERTIM | TIMS | 6 | UZEIT | ||||
ERNAM | Name of Person who Created the Object | ERNAM | CHAR | 12 | USNAM | ||||
AEDAT | Changed On | AEDAT | DATS | 8 | DATUM | ||||
AEZEIT | Time of day the record was changed | OI0_AETIM | TIMS | 6 | UZEIT | ||||
AENAM | Name of Person Who Changed Object | AENAM | CHAR | 12 | USNAM | ||||
BLOIND | Blocking indicator | OIJ_BLOIND | CHAR | 1 | XFELD | ||||
DELIND | Deletion indicator | OIJ_DELIND | CHAR | 1 | XFELD | ||||
RDACT | Stock Projection activation indicator | OIJ_RDACT | CHAR | 1 | XFELD | ||||
PMATNR | Material Number | MATNR | CHAR | 18 | Assigned to domain | MATN1 | MATNR | MAT | S_MAT1 |
